Key Metrics Compared
Official Data| Metric | Eastern Michigan University | Grand Valley State University |
|---|---|---|
| Acceptance Rate | 81% | 95% |
| Graduation Rate | 46% | 67% |
| Avg Earnings (5yr) | $43,148 | $47,840 |
| Median Debt | $25,000 | $24,500 |
| Tuition (In-State) | $15,510 | $14,628 |
| Retention Rate | 68% | 77% |
| Financial Aid | 46% | 49% |
Comparison Analysis
Graduates of Grand Valley State University earn more than Eastern Michigan University graduates. The median earnings for Grand Valley State University graduates are $47,840, while Eastern Michigan University graduates earn $43,148. Grand Valley State University also has a higher graduation rate, with 67.4% of students graduating compared to Eastern Michigan University's 45.5% graduation rate. However, Eastern Michigan University has a slightly lower acceptance rate at 81.4% compared to Grand Valley State University's 94.7%.
Eastern Michigan University has a higher tuition cost than Grand Valley State University. Tuition at Eastern Michigan University is $15,510, while Grand Valley State University's tuition is $14,628.
Overall, Grand Valley State University appears to offer a better value proposition based on higher earnings and graduation rates, despite a slightly higher acceptance rate. Students may consider earnings potential and graduation rates as key decision factors.
